Pregunta frecuente: ¿Cuáles son los tipos de dispositivos en Unix?

Hay dos tipos generales de archivos de dispositivo en sistemas operativos similares a Unix, conocidos como archivos especiales de caracteres y archivos especiales de bloque. La diferencia entre ellos radica en la cantidad de datos que el sistema operativo y el hardware leen y escriben.

¿Cuáles son los diferentes tipos de Unix?

Los siete tipos de archivos estándar de Unix son regular, directorio, enlace simbólico, especial FIFO, especial de bloque, especial de carácter y socket según lo definido por POSIX. Las diferentes implementaciones específicas del sistema operativo permiten más tipos de los que requiere POSIX (por ejemplo, puertas Solaris).

¿Cómo se representan los dispositivos en Unix?

Todos los dispositivos están representados por archivos llamados archivos especiales que se encuentran en el directorio / dev. Por lo tanto, los archivos de dispositivo y otros archivos se nombran y acceden de la misma manera. Un 'archivo normal' es simplemente un archivo de datos normal en el disco.

¿Cuáles son los dos tipos de archivos de dispositivo en Linux?

Hay dos tipos de archivos de dispositivo según la forma en que el sistema operativo y el hardware procesan los datos que se escriben y leen en ellos: archivos especiales de caracteres o dispositivos de caracteres. Bloquear archivos especiales o Bloquear dispositivos.

¿Qué son los dispositivos de caracteres en Linux?

Los dispositivos de caracteres son dispositivos que no tienen medios de almacenamiento direccionables físicamente, como unidades de cinta o puertos serie, donde la E / S normalmente se realiza en un flujo de bytes.

¿Cuáles son las características principales de Unix?

El sistema operativo UNIX admite las siguientes características y capacidades:

  • Multitarea y multiusuario.
  • Interfaz de programación.
  • Uso de archivos como abstracciones de dispositivos y otros objetos.
  • Redes integradas (TCP / IP es estándar)
  • Procesos de servicio del sistema persistentes denominados "daemons" y gestionados por init o inet.

¿Es Windows Unix?

Aparte de los sistemas operativos basados ​​en Windows NT de Microsoft, casi todo lo demás se remonta a Unix. Linux, Mac OS X, Android, iOS, Chrome OS, Orbis OS utilizados en PlayStation 4, cualquier firmware que se esté ejecutando en su enrutador, todos estos sistemas operativos a menudo se denominan sistemas operativos "similares a Unix".

¿Qué es un dispositivo Unix?

En los sistemas operativos similares a Unix, un archivo de dispositivo o un archivo especial es una interfaz para un controlador de dispositivo que aparece en un sistema de archivos como si fuera un archivo normal. … Estos archivos especiales permiten que un programa de aplicación interactúe con un dispositivo utilizando su controlador de dispositivo a través de llamadas estándar del sistema de entrada / salida.

¿Cuáles son los diferentes tipos de archivos en Linux?

Linux admite siete tipos diferentes de archivos. Estos tipos de archivos son el archivo normal, el archivo de directorio, el archivo de vínculo, el archivo especial de carácter, el archivo especial de bloque, el archivo de socket y el archivo de canalización con nombre. La siguiente tabla proporciona una breve descripción de estos tipos de archivos.

¿Dónde se almacenan los archivos de dispositivo en Linux?

Todos los archivos de dispositivo de Linux se encuentran en el directorio / dev, que es una parte integral del sistema de archivos raíz (/) porque estos archivos de dispositivo deben estar disponibles para el sistema operativo durante el proceso de arranque.

¿Qué es mkdir?

El comando mkdir en Linux / Unix permite a los usuarios crear o crear nuevos directorios. mkdir significa "crear directorio". Con mkdir, también puede establecer permisos, crear varios directorios (carpetas) a la vez y mucho más.

¿Qué es el archivo de dispositivo de caracteres?

Los dispositivos de caracteres son cosas como tarjetas de audio o gráficas, o dispositivos de entrada como el teclado y el mouse. En cada caso, cuando el kernel carga el controlador correcto (ya sea en el momento del arranque o mediante programas como udev), escanea los distintos buses para ver si algún dispositivo manejado por ese controlador está realmente presente en el sistema.

¿Qué son los nodos de dispositivo?

Un nodo de dispositivo, un archivo de dispositivo o un archivo especial de dispositivo es un tipo de archivo especial que se utiliza en muchos sistemas operativos similares a Unix, incluido Linux. Los nodos de dispositivo facilitan la comunicación transparente entre las aplicaciones de espacio de usuario y el hardware de la computadora.

¿Qué son los dispositivos de bloque en Linux?

Los dispositivos de bloque se caracterizan por el acceso aleatorio a los datos organizados en bloques de tamaño fijo. Ejemplos de tales dispositivos son discos duros, unidades de CD-ROM, discos RAM, etc.… Para simplificar el trabajo con dispositivos de bloque, el kernel de Linux proporciona un subsistema completo llamado subsistema de E / S de bloque (o capa de bloque).

¿Como esta publicación? Comparte con tus amigos:
SO hoy